Heat Shock Proteins and Small Nucleolar RNAs are Dysregulated in a Drosophila Model for Feline Hypertrophic Cardiomyopathy. Heat Shock Proteins and Small Nucleolar RNAs are Dysregulated in a Drosophila Model for Feline Hypertrophic Cardiomyopathy

We report the application of RNA-sequencing technology for high-throughput profiling of Drosophila that express clinical variants of feline-MyBPC3 associated with Hypertrophic Cardiomyopathy (HCM). Overall design: Differential expression analyses comparing transcriptome-wide effects of wild-type feline-MyBPC3 compared to the clinical variants (A31P and R820W) in a Drosophila model for feline Hypertrophic Cardiomyopathy (HCM).
